Why shouldn't classes overlap when summarizing continuous data in a frequency or relative frequency distribution? choose the correct answer below. a. classes shouldn't overlap so that the distribution is not skewed in one direction. b. classes shouldn't overlap so that the class width is as small as possible. c. classes shouldn't overlap so there is no confusion as to which class an observation belongs. d. classes shouldn't overlap so that they are open ended.

C. Classes shouldn't overlap so there is no confusion as to which class an observation belongs.
Explanation:
When summarizing data that is continuous in a frequency or relative frequency distribution, the classes should be accurately entered to avoid overlapping.This is because overlapping causes confusion between classes and observations.Consequently leading to wrong results from the data.Ответ:
